The cleanroom technology market encompasses the specialized design, construction, and maintenance of controlled environments where airborne particulates, microbes, and other contaminants are minimized to strict predefined levels. These environments are integral to sectors requiring stringent contamination control, such as p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, semiconductors, and advanced manufacturing. The market demand is intensifying due to rising regulatory compliance pressures, increased biopharmaceutical production, and the shift toward high-precision fabrication processes. Growth drivers include the proliferation of biologics and personalized medicine, rising microelectronics miniaturization, and advancements in nanotechnology that necessitate ultra-clean operational settings.

The trend toward modular, scalable cleanroom systems and the integration of IoT for real-time monitoring is reshaping facility design and functionality. Energy efficiency, smart airflow control, and automated contamination detection are becoming standard, reflecting a broader industry shift toward sustainability and digitalization. Opportunities in the market expansion lie in the increasing need for sterile processing environments across R&D, pilot-scale production, and commercial manufacturing.

Emerging innovations such as AI-driven HVAC control systems, pre-fabricated cleanroom units, and contamination-resistant materials are attracting capital investments and strategic collaborations. Demand for consumables is rising in tandem with cleanroom density, particularly in GMP-regulated sectors. The market is also benefiting from the surge in outsourcing and contract manufacturing, prompting facilities to adopt flexible and compliant cleanroom infrastructures. Driven by evolving quality benchmarks and precision-driven applications, the market is transitioning into a high-value, innovation-intensive space characterized by advanced integration, customization, and regulatory alignment.

Cleanroom Technology Market Report Highlights

  • In terms of product, in 2024, the consumables segment accounted for a larger market share due to the recurring and high-volume usage of gloves, garments, wipes, disinfectants, and face masks across cleanroom-dependent sectors.
  • Based on end use, in 2024, the pharmaceutical industry segment accounted for the largest share due to its stringent contamination control requirements for sterile drug production.
  • In 2024, North America held the largest market share due to the region’s advanced healthcare infrastructure, stringent regulatory oversight, and high concentration of pharmaceutical and biotechnology manufacturers.
  • The Asia Pacific market is projected to experience the highest CAGR during the forecast period due to rapid industrialization, increasing pharmaceutical and semiconductor production, and rising investments in healthcare infrastructure.
